The range of a set of numbers is the difference between the highest and lowest values. Find these and subtract the lowest from the highest.
The range of a group of numbers is the difference between the highest and lowest numbers

The first step is to sort the numbers from highest to lowest. The range is then the difference between the first and last numbers, or the highest and lowest.
The lowest and highest prime numbers between 1 and 100 are 2 and 97 respectively.
Any number can be the lowest as well the highest of a set only if all the numbers are the same.
